The Mechanics Behind Cross-Device Compatibility in Jump-and-Run Titles
Achieving seamless gameplay on multiple device types involves addressing a host of technical and experiential factors:
- Adaptive Control Schemes: Transitioning from physical controllers to touch inputs requires intuitive gesture-based controls that maintain responsiveness. Frog Jumper, for example, employs simplified tap and swipe mechanics that are easily learnable but rewarding in execution.
- Performance Optimization: Diverse hardware specifications necessitate scalable graphics and frame rates. Developers often utilize lightweight assets and adaptive quality settings to ensure smooth gameplay across entry-level smartphones and high-end tablets alike.
- Device-Specific Features: Leveraging features such as accelerometers or haptic feedback can heighten immersion. A well-designed game intelligently incorporates these elements without compromising usability, which is possible through careful testing and modular design approaches.
